How much does a unit secretary make?

The average unit secretary salary in the United States is $32,153. Unit secretary salaries typically range between $25,000 and $40,000 yearly. The average hourly rate for unit secretaries is $15.46 per hour.

Unit secretary salary is impacted by location, education, and experience. Unit secretaries earn the highest average salary in California.

Unit Secretary salary trends

The average unit secretary salary has risen by $5,415 over the last ten years. In 2014, the average unit secretary earned $26,738 annually, but today, they earn $32,153 a year. That works out to a 11% change in pay for unit secretaries over the last decade.
